This release updates the Harrowfield telemetry gateway used by Cropline-equipped tractors and balers. Message batching now flushes every 15 seconds instead of 60, reducing alert lag for implement fault codes. Added automatic reconnect with jittered backoff after cellular dropouts, which should cut the overnight gap alerts on-call has been paging on. Firmware older than v4.9 is no longer accepted; affected units will appear in the rejection dashboard. For escalations during rollout, the responsible engineer is listed below.

account owner for bawip-tahag: Raleth Quenok

Hi Dano,

Handing off TranscodeBarn. Node pool C is draining after repeated ffprobe hangs; leave it cordoned until the kernel patch lands. Queue depth is normal, but watch the 4K HDR lane — retries spiked twice overnight. Dashboards are pinned in the oncall channel. If anything in the HDR lane pages you again, escalate straight to the media infra lead.

alerts address for fahip-kajep: istox.fraox@qorvellabs.internal

**Q: A customer reports their Hargrove telemetry gateway shows tractors as offline even though the machines are running. What should I check first?**

A: Most cases are cellular backhaul gaps, not gateway faults. Confirm the gateway's last heartbeat timestamp, then check whether buffered readings arrive once coverage returns. If buffering fails, escalate to tier two. The full diagnostic flowchart is on the internal page here.

wiki page, faduf-tagaf: https://superset.halixdata.example/build